Software Test Automation- Approach on evaluating test automation tools
      Tarik Sheth, Dr. Santosh Kumar Singh
Abstract: The aim of this paper is to evaluate and establish a mechanism to evaluate testing tools effectively, at the moment, there are many complex systems are built across the platforms and it is very complex problem to establish one common criterion to evaluate the testing tools. There are lot many tools available in the market at the moment, each to0ls have its own features to test software. For this paper, test cases are first manually tested and then as a part of the regression execution, same test cases are coded in the test scripts and being executed over the application under test. Automated testing is developed which saves time and resources, providing a good ROI. Test automation speeds up the testing process and minimizing time to market. An important contribution of this paper is the development of the metric suite that facilitates comparison and selection of a desired testing tool for automated testing.
